I figured out what the issue was - the perk image was displaying as normal but FallUI adds a filter(or something) to color the interface. Because part of the Size Queen image (the vaultsuit) is blue almost any color other than white makes it impossible to see that part, and some make it look bad. I suppose you could release a greyscale version of the image for compatibility but here's a workaround: The fix is to change one setting to white or close enough MCM > FallUI - Inventory > Interface > Coloring > (Pipboy) Dual colors ON and Dual Color White

In the TSEX MCM you can find settings to bind a hotkey for bringing up the TSEX menu. Pressing whatever hotkey you associate with it will allow you to switch between dialogue modes, enter suggestive or submissive positions, change your mood... and also masturbate. 2 hours ago, Lenore said: Either way, I enjoyed the mod, tyvm for making it and I'll look forward to future releases Thanks!
